all the plugs on your dx harness will plug into the b16 except for the distributor and injectors. the b16 harness used for the plugs only pretty much, you will need the distributor plug, the colors should match up except for two wires, blue/green?and blue/yellow? correct me if i'm wrong, i'm just going off the top of my head right now. also you will need all the injector plugs and a resistor box, may have this item on the harness and may not, its a gray metal box with cooling fins on it, search it for a pix. then its time to do a dpfi to mpfi conversion. search that too for more info
